We show here that MDL 73404, a water soluble analog of alpha-tocophero
l, provides protective and healing effects in dextran sulfate sodium-m
ediated colitis in mice. MDL 73404, showed significant dose response a
t all levels of the disease. The maximum effective dose was 10 mg/kg/d
ay, p.o. and the ED(50) dose was 1.75 mg/kg/day, p.o. (mean). Histolog
y showed remarkable prevention or healing depending upon the protocol.
In all protocols, MDL 73404 was significantly better than olsalazine
(150 mg/kg/day, p.o.). MDL 73404 also inhibited PGE(2), 6-keto-PGF(1al
pha), TXB(2), and LTB(4). These results suggest that MDL 73404 provide
s protective and healing effects in this model.
